Alex a écrit :



- My budget is around £650 (that's around $975 for you US folk).
- The type of music I mostly listen to is Rock and Metal.
- The approximate dimensions of my room is 3.5m by 2.5m.


Hello Alex,

Considering the above parameters may I suggest you the following :

1. Purchase immediately second hand "good" elements for a maximum amount
of 1/4 of your today budget.
2. Put the rest of your budget in bank at 4.5 - 5% per year.
3. Continue to save money for your project.
4. During this time you should borrow music from your neighbourhood
media libraries to educate your ear.

Finally let say that in 2 or 3 years you will have a nice amount of
money to purchase a very good music system.

*Bonus* : you will also have good music to listen on !
